100% Resale.

I will buy direct sub $190 pretty much anywhere for the membership perks if that ever comes around.

If that doesn't happen within the next 2 years ( we have plans to stay at resorts in the next two years that don't have restrictions) I will buy an SSR SAP contract and rent out my AKV or BLT points whenever I want to stay at Riv, which won't be every year or possibly every 2 years which is why I don't want to buy resale there. I hate feeling locked in to one place. I feel like timeshares are already restricted without adding more restrictions.

Love Riv, but don't feel the current resale prices reflect what only being able to stay at 1 resort should be worth. I would buy for just one restricted resort at the same price Vero is currently going for. I can't imagine what these other resorts that are struggling to be sold direct (CFW) will go for resale.

I used to be in the camp that restricted would retain its resale value, but I've since changed my mind. I think that waiting to buy direct is the smart thing to do, I would be shocked if there isn't some kind of deal that's going to happen with all this uncertainty.
